The Lord says, “I
will guide you along the best pathway for your life. I will advise you and
watch over you.” Psalm 32:8
Several years ago, I
went out on a long motorcycle ride up through Alabama. There are plenty of
beautiful country roads that make riding a motorcycle enjoyable. After many
hours of riding, time had escaped me and I needed to get home rather quickly. I
decided to part from the 2-lane road and get on the interstate to make up some
time. My GPS kept telling me to turn off onto a 2-lane road, but I kept going.
Eventually I ran into a very long line of cars, slowly creeping along the
interstate due to a semi-truck accident 2 miles ahead. It was about 90 plus
degrees and I was a sweating mess. If only I had followed my GPS, I would have
gotten home sooner than my experience on the interstate.
Do you ever wonder
why God waits so long to answer your prayers or receive His blessings? We get
it fixed in our minds how we expect things to go when we call upon God, and head
in that direction, totally missing His still quiet voice telling us another
path towards His answers, His blessings. The truth is, we are the reason for
delayed answers, because we fail to follow Him closely.
Prayer and focus on
God is essential to keeping in step with His wisdom and guidance. He sees what’s
up ahead and will redirect your steps to keep you from disaster. He promised to
always provide us His best. Sometimes it takes a lot of faith in God to let Him
direct your path, but essential if you want His very best for your life.
Maybe you are on a
pathway, seeking God’s wisdom. Are you staying prayed up, are you looking for
signs that detour your current direction? Be ready and willing to do everything
He says in the process of answering your request and you’ll soon recognize His promised
delivery came at just the right moment. Follow Him in faith and He’ll get you
there on time, every time! God bless!
